Members of the State Parliament requested Information about Official Cars

Published June 11, 2015
Share
SHARE

delegates of the parliamentary assembly of B&HMember of the House of Representatives of the Parliamentary Assembly of B&H, Mirsad Djonlagic, requested at yesterday’s session of the House of Representatives, from Council of Ministers of B&H to provide information on the number of official cars of the B&H Presidency, Council of Ministers of B&H and the Parliamentary Assembly of B&H.

Djonlagic said that cars with the entourage represent a serious threat to traffic if the quality of roads in B&H is taken into account, and requested to be provided with the information about how the use of official cars is regulated.

Also, a delegate Salko Sokolovic  requested to be provided with the information on whether the State Investigation and Protection Agency (SIPA) bought seven new cars of Citroen brand and where the advertisement that should be in accordance with the Law on Public Procurement was published.

A deputy minister of security of B&H, Mijo Kresic answered to Sokolovic, and said that the Police Support Agency haven’t bought those cars  and that the Ministry of Security of B&H just sent a request to SIPA,  i.e. that because of that he was not able to answer to this question at yesterday’s session.

The Chairman of the Council of Ministers of B&H, Denis Zvizdic said that the reform agenda will be included in the session of the Council of Ministers of B&H.
